October 09
Saturday 09, 2004:
The tri-annual federal election is held in Australia and Liberal Party of Australia leader, John Howard, wins a fourth term as Prime Minister in a landslide victory over opponent, Mark Latham of the Australian Labor Party.
Monday 09, 1967:
A day after being caught, Che Guevara is executed for attempting to incite a revolution in Bolivia.
Wednesday 09, 1940:
During a nighttime air raid by the German Luftwaffe, St. Paul's Cathedral is pierced by a bomb.
Friday 09, 1936:
Generators at Boulder Dam (later renamed to Hoover Dam) begin to transmit electricity from the Colorado River 266 miles to Los Angeles, California.
Wednesday 09, 1771:
The Dutch merchant ship Vrouw Maria sinks near the coast of Finland.
